## Who to ping about GiftNote

Welcome aboard! GiftNote is our donation-receipt mailer for the Larchfield Fund. Template tweaks go to the comms folks; delivery failures and bounce weirdness go to the platform crew. Don't push template changes on Fridays — receipts batch over the weekend. For anything GiftNote-related, start with the address below.

billing contact of kaweg-tajeg = drudor.lamion.oliath@torvalabs.test

## Tuning

Request tracing in the Corvane platform samples spans at the edge gateway and propagates context through every downstream hop. As a contractor, you'll mostly adjust sampling rates and span buffer sizes when a service gets noisy. Raise sampling cautiously — the Nettlewick collector has fixed ingest capacity, and oversampling one service starves the rest. Changes require a config redeploy, not a restart. The defaults shipped with each service are shown below.

tuning constants:
QUOTAS = {
    "quenael": 10,
    "oliwyn": 1,
}

## Changed defaults — Brindlescan integration

As of release 4.2, the Brindlescan barcode scanner integration no longer falls back to keyboard-wedge mode. Serial capture is now the default, and unknown symbologies are rejected instead of logged. Retry counts were lowered to surface hardware faults sooner. New installs pick these up automatically; existing sites should verify their overrides against the defaults listed below.

service settings:
PRAIX_LOG_LEVEL=error
PRAIX_METRICS_HOST=metrics.praix.qorvelcorp.corp
PRAIX_POOL_SIZE=16